Pat,
At three weeks post-op I was feeling all kinds of strange twinges, tugs, shooting pains, pulls, and a constant pain that set in around where I thought my left ovary would be located. The next week it moved to the right side. I have seen several posts about right or left sided pain around the 3 week mark. I assumed since there were so many complaints, it was just a normal healing pain. After the 4th week, it was gone. You are at a time in your recovery where alot of nerves are waking up from the shock and regenerating. You are likely to feel some new and different discomforts.
I have also heard that, during the first few months when you ovulate, the pain will be a little more intense than it was pre-surgery. It will take a few months for your system to be functioning as before.
Just beware of any fever which could indicate an infection.

Some of us used our old left-over pads on our leaky incisions. They came in handy once again!!
